请启用Javascript以获得更好的浏览体验~
0755-3394 2933
在线咨询
演示申请
Vue.js开发微信小程序的全面指南
Vue.js开发微信小程序的全面指南

本文将深入探讨如何使用Vue.js进行微信小程序的开发,从基础到进阶,为您提供全面的指导和实战技巧。

Vue.js开发微信小程序的全面指南一、引言

随着移动互联网的快速发展,微信小程序作为一种轻量级的应用形式,受到了越来越多开发者和用户的青睐。而Vue.js作为前端开发中流行的框架之一,其组件化、数据绑定等特性使得开发过程更加高效和便捷。本文将介绍如何使用Vue.js进行微信小程序的开发,帮助开发者更好地掌握这一技能。

二、Vue.js与微信小程序的关系

Vue.js与微信小程序虽然都是前端技术,但它们的应用场景和生态系统有所不同。Vue.js主要用于Web开发,而微信小程序则专注于移动端应用。然而,通过一些工具和框架,我们可以将Vue.js的技能应用到微信小程序的开发中。

三、Vue.js开发微信小程序的基础准备

  1. 安装Node.js和npm:Vue.js开发依赖于Node.js环境,因此需要先安装Node.js和npm。
  2. 安装Vue CLI:Vue CLI是Vue.js的脚手架工具,可以方便地创建和管理Vue.js项目。
  3. 安装微信开发者工具:微信开发者工具是开发微信小程序的必备工具,提供了代码编辑、预览、调试等功能。

四、使用Vue.js开发微信小程序的关键技术

  1. 组件化开发:Vue.js的组件化思想可以很好地应用到微信小程序中。通过将页面拆分成多个组件,可以提高代码的可复用性和可维护性。
  2. 数据绑定:Vue.js的数据绑定机制使得数据的变化能够实时反映到视图上,这在微信小程序中同样适用。
  3. 生命周期钩子:Vue.js和微信小程序都有自己的生命周期钩子函数,开发者需要在合适的时机执行相应的操作。
  4. 路由管理:虽然微信小程序没有像Vue.js那样的路由管理功能,但可以通过页面跳转和参数传递来实现类似的效果。

五、实战案例:使用Vue.js开发一个简单的微信小程序

  1. 创建项目:使用Vue CLI创建一个新的Vue项目,并配置微信小程序的相关依赖。
  2. 设计页面结构:根据需求设计页面结构,并使用Vue组件进行拆分。
  3. 实现数据绑定和交互:利用Vue的数据绑定机制实现页面数据的动态更新,并添加相应的交互逻辑。
  4. 调试和优化:使用微信开发者工具进行调试和优化,确保小程序在不同设备和网络环境下的表现一致。

六、性能优化与最佳实践

  1. 减少不必要的DOM操作:频繁的DOM操作会影响小程序的性能,因此应尽量减少不必要的DOM操作。
  2. 合理使用异步请求:异步请求过多会导致小程序卡顿或崩溃,因此应合理使用异步请求并控制请求频率。
  3. 图片优化:图片是小程序中占用资源较多的元素之一,因此应对图片进行压缩和优化处理。
  4. 代码拆分与懒加载:将代码拆分成多个模块并实现懒加载可以提高小程序的加载速度和性能表现。

七、跨平台开发策略

虽然Vue.js主要用于Web开发,但通过一些跨平台框架(如Uni-app)可以将Vue.js代码转换为微信小程序、H5、App等多个平台的代码。这为开发者提供了更多的选择和灵活性。

八、总结与展望

本文介绍了如何使用Vue.js进行微信小程序的开发,从基础准备到关键技术再到实战案例和性能优化等方面进行了全面的探讨。随着前端技术的不断发展和微信小程序的日益普及,相信Vue.js在微信小程序开发中的应用将会越来越广泛。未来,我们可以期待更多优秀的Vue.js框架和工具出现,为开发者提供更加便捷和高效的开发体验。